How is horsepower calculated?
Horsepower is a unit of power or the rate at which work is done. It is commonly used to measure the output of engines and motors. The most common way to calculate horsepower is to use a formula called Brake Horsepower (BHP). How do I choose a snow blower?
Choosing the right snow blower can be an important decision, especially if you live in an area with frequent snowfall. There are a few key factors to consider when selecting a snow blower.
First, consider the size of your property and the amount of snowfall you typically receive in a given season. If you have a large yard or driveway, you will want to choose a larger and more powerful snow blower. On the other hand, if you have a smaller area to clear, a smaller and lighter snow blower may be a better option.
Second, consider the types of snow you will be dealing with. If you live in an area that receives light, powdery snow, you won’t need the same power as you would if you live in an area with heavy, wet snow. Knowing the type of snow you will likely be dealing with can help you choose the right machine.
Third, consider the features you need. Are you looking for a snow blower with a heated handle? Do you need one that can clear deep snow? Do you need a snow blower that is easy to maneuver? Knowing the features you need can help you narrow down your choices.
Finally, consider your budget. Snow blowers can range in price from a few hundred dollars for basic models to several thousand for top-of-the-line models. Knowing what you can afford can help you pick the perfect snow blower for your needs.
By considering these factors, you can make an informed decision and choose the perfect snow blower for your needs.
